สุภาษิต 4:2
For I give you good doctrine, forsake ye not my law.
Context
This verse from สุภาษิต Chapter 4 connects to 10 cross-references. The father recalls his own father's instruction urging him to get wisdom above all else and cherish her so she will protect him. He contrasts the path of the righteous, which shines brighter until full day, with the way of …
